Understanding Electrical Wiring Principles

Before we dive into the specifics of wiring your Chamberlain garage door opener, it’s important to understand some basic principles of electrical wiring. Electrical wiring is a system of conductors and devices that carry electrical current from one point to another. The current flows through the conductors in a closed loop, which is called a circuit.

There are two types of electrical circuits: series and parallel. In a series circuit, the current flows through each device in sequence. In a parallel circuit, the current splits into multiple paths and flows through each device at the same time. Most household electrical circuits are parallel circuits.

Q: What if my Chamberlain garage door opener isn’t working?

A: If your Chamberlain garage door opener isn’t working, there are several things you can check. First, make sure the power is on and that the opener is plugged in. Check the fuse or circuit breaker that controls the opener to make sure it hasn’t tripped. If the fuse or breaker is fine, check the wiring connections to make sure they’re secure and properly connected. If you’re still having problems, consult the troubleshooting section of the owner’s manual or contact Chamberlain customer support.
